In this intriguing collection, readers step into the world shaped by Ezra Pound's visionary poetry, deftly illuminated by Mary de Rachewiltz. With dynamic and thought-provoking verses, the text explores themes that resonate through time, offering insights into the human experience, culture, and society.
Through a blend of rich imagery and complex ideas, Pound’s work challenges the reader to think deeply about the intricacies of love, history, and art. De Rachewiltz contributes her own voice, weaving together a tapestry that showcases the nuances of Pound's thoughts while adding her distinct flair.
Set against the backdrop of early 20th-century literary movements, this edition serves not only as a testament to Pound's genius but also as an invitation to reflect on the enduring power of poetry. It's more than just words on a page; it’s a journey into the minds of two talented literary figures who push the boundaries of expression and thought.
